Factors to Consider When Choosing Walkie Talkies For Survival

Choosing the right walkie talkie for survival involves weighing several key factors beyond basic features. Range is vital but must be balanced with battery life and durability, especially for extended outdoor use. Weather resistance, including waterproofing and shockproof design, can make or break your device’s longevity in tough environments. User interface and ease of operation matter, particularly if your survival situation demands quick, instinctive use. Licensing requirements, especially for HAM radios, can influence your choice based on your readiness to handle regulatory aspects. Finally, consider whether you need additional emergency features like NOAA alerts or SOS functions, which can provide vital safety support when it matters most.

Range and Power

Range is often the most advertised feature, but real-world conditions like terrain and obstacles can significantly affect it. Longer range models typically operate at higher wattages and may require more power, which impacts battery life. For wilderness survival, a reliable range of 10 miles or more is recommended, but keep in mind that more powerful devices tend to be bulkier and more expensive. Consider your typical environment and whether extended range justifies the tradeoff in size or complexity.

Durability and Weather Resistance

Devices intended for survival must withstand exposure to water, dust, and shocks. Waterproof ratings like IP67 or IP68 are ideal, especially if you’ll be in wet or muddy environments. Rugged construction adds weight but greatly enhances longevity. Cheaper or lighter models may crack or fail under tough conditions, so investing in a waterproof, shockproof device can be a lifesaver in extreme situations.

Emergency Features

Features like NOAA weather alerts, SOS alarms, and built-in flashlights can turn a walkie talkie from a simple communication device into a comprehensive survival tool. These features can provide critical updates and safety signals when other communication methods fail. However, they often come with a higher price tag and may complicate the device’s interface. Prioritize these features if you expect to rely on your radio during severe weather or emergencies.

Ease of Use and Licensing

Some walkie talkies, especially HAM radios, require licensing and a learning curve to operate effectively. Simpler models like FRS or GMRS radios are easier for most users and do not require licensing but may have limited features or range. Consider your comfort level with technology and whether you’re willing to handle licensing processes or prefer straightforward plug-and-play devices. Ease of use can be critical in high-stress survival situations.

Battery Life and Power Options

Extended battery life ensures your device remains operational when most needed. Rechargeable lithium-ion batteries are common, but models with multiple power options—such as solar charging, hand crank, or replaceable batteries—offer added security. Devices with low power consumption or power-saving modes can also be advantageous for prolonged survival scenarios where charging options are limited.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need a license to use walkie talkies for survival?

Most consumer-grade walkie talkies, like FRS and GMRS models, do not require a license to operate in many regions, making them accessible for most users. However, HAM radios like the Baofeng UV-5R do require licensing and some knowledge of radio operation, which can be a barrier for casual users. If you prefer a simple, license-free device, focus on FRS or GMRS models; if you want advanced features and are willing to handle licensing, HAM radios offer greater flexibility and range.

How important is waterproofing for survival walkie talkies?

Waterproofing is crucial if you expect to encounter rain, snow, or wet environments. A device with a high waterproof rating, such as IP67 or IP68, can be submerged temporarily without damage, significantly extending its lifespan and reliability. In survival situations, a waterproof radio can be the difference between maintaining communication or losing your connection due to water damage. Investing in water-resistant models is highly recommended for outdoor or flood-prone areas.

What range should I look for in a walkie talkie for outdoor survival?

For outdoor survival, a range of at least 10 miles is advisable, although actual distance may vary based on terrain and obstructions. Open, flat areas will allow your radio to reach its maximum advertised range, while dense forests or urban environments will reduce it. Consider models that specify real-world range tests and choose one that exceeds your typical operational needs to ensure reliable communication in emergencies.

Are emergency features like NOAA alerts necessary?

Emergency features such as NOAA weather alerts, SOS signals, and built-in flashlights can greatly enhance safety during crises. They provide critical updates and quick signaling options without relying on cellular networks, which may be down. While these features can increase the cost and complexity of your device, their presence adds a layer of security, especially in unpredictable or severe weather conditions.

How do I choose between a simple walkie talkie and a HAM radio?

Choosing between a simple walkie talkie and a HAM radio depends on your needs and willingness to learn. Basic models like FRS/GMRS radios are easy to operate, license-free, and suitable for most survival situations. HAM radios offer longer range, more customization, and additional features but require licensing and some technical knowledge. If you need straightforward communication without hassle, a consumer-grade walkie talkie is generally sufficient; for more advanced, long-distance communication, HAM radios are better despite the learning curve.
